OSI-Certified logo

Source code of file adm_mkroot.php
from the Content Management module for Phprojekt.

<?php
// Content Management System module for PHProjekt (CMS4P).
// Copyright 2002-2005 by Mario A. Valdez-Ramirez
// http://www.mariovaldez.net/

// This program is free software; you can redistribute it and/or modify
// it under the terms of the GNU General Public License as published by
// the Free Software Foundation; either version 2 of the License, or
// (at your option) any later version.

// This program is distributed in the hope that it will be useful,
// but WITHOUT ANY WARRANTY; without even the implied warranty of
// MERCHANTABILITY or FITNESS FOR A PARTICULAR PURPOSE.  See the
// GNU General Public License for more details.

// You should have received a copy of the GNU General Public License
// along with this program; if not, write to the Free Software
// Foundation, Inc., 59 Temple Place - Suite 330, 
// Boston, MA 02111-1307, USA.

// You can contact Mario A. Valdez-Ramirez by email 
// at mario@mariovaldez.org or paper mail at 
// Olmos 809, San Nicolas, NL. 66495, Mexico.

//session_start();
$file "adm_mkroot";
$path_pre="../";
$include_path $path_pre "lib/lib.inc.php";
include_once 
$include_path;
include_once (
$path_pre "cm/cm_lib.inc.php");
fcm_load_secdb ($cm_security);
echo 
$cm_html_header;


if (
$cmru) {
  echo 
"<p class=\"setupreturn\"><a class=\"cms\"href=\"" $cmru ".php\">{$cm_text["setup-return"]}</a></p>";
}


if ((
$cm_superuser) && ($cm_superuser == $user_kurz)) {
  if (
$cm_createdir) {
    if (!
$cm_mainroot) {
      
$cm_mainroot "root";
    }
    echo 
"<p class=\"titletext\">{$cm_text["setup-creatingdir"]} $cm_mainroot</p>";
    if (
file_exists ($cm_mainroot)) {
      echo 
"<p class=\"setuperror\">{$cm_text["setup-direxists"]}</p>";
    }
    else {
      if (@
mkdir ($cm_mainroot0777)) {
        echo 
"<p class=\"titletext\">{$cm_text["setup-createddir"]}</p>";
      }
      else {
        echo 
"<p class=\"setuperror\">{$cm_text["setup-cannotcreatedir"]}</p>";
      }
    }
  }
  else {
    echo 
"
    <p class=\"titletext\">
{$cm_text["setup-welcomedir"]}<br>";
  }
  echo 
"<hr><form class=\"cms\" action=\"adm_mkroot.php\" method=\"post\">";
  echo 
"<input type=\"hidden\" name=\"cmru\" value=\"$cmru\">";
  echo 
"<input class=\"cms\" type=\"submit\" name=\"cm_createdir\" value=\"{$cm_text["setup-createdir"]}\">";
  echo 
"</form>";
}
else {
  echo 
"<p class=\"titletext\">{$cm_text["setup-welcomedir"]}</p>";
  echo 
"<p class=\"generaltext\">{$cm_text["setup-currentuser"]} <strong>$user_kurz</strong><br>";
  echo 
"{$cm_text["setup-superuseris"]} <strong>$cm_superuser</strong></p>";
  echo 
"<h3 class=\"setuperror\">{$cm_text["setup-nosuperuserdb"]}</h3>";
}

if (
$cmru) {
  echo 
"<p class=\"setupreturn\"><a class=\"cms\"href=\"" $cmru ".php\">{$cm_text["setup-return"]}</a></p>";
}

echo 
"</body></html>";
?>
 
 
NA fum/lmd: 2004.09.16
Copyright ©1994-2018 by Mario A. Valdez-Ramírez.
no siga este enlace / do not follow this link